在多線程之Thread狀態(tài)[http://www.reibang.com/p/5f0d7f52f93b]中哪亿,我們提到,當(dāng)一個線程由于各種原因箭阶,...
對于線程的定義挤安,這里就不贅述了谚殊。但是有一點(diǎn)需要明確,對于單核處理器蛤铜,即任何一個時候如果只有一顆CPU在工作嫩絮,那么就只可能存在線程并發(fā),不存在線程...
繼承Shiro和Spring時围肥,我們都知道要先通過web.xml部署描述符或者其他方式剿干,向ServletContext添加過濾器。因?yàn)橐?..
接口javax.servlet.ServletRequest聲明了相當(dāng)多的方法穆刻。其中值得關(guān)注的方法有: 一對set/getAttribut...
javax.servlet.Servlet接口定義了一些方法怨愤。關(guān)鍵的是其中四個: 本來接口Servlet的直接抽象實(shí)現(xiàn)類是jav...
JdbcRealm是Shiro提供的另外一種Realm實(shí)現(xiàn),當(dāng)記錄用戶身份蛹批、角色、權(quán)限的信息存儲在數(shù)據(jù)庫中就應(yīng)該使用這種實(shí)現(xiàn)篮愉。通過它的名...
IniRealm是Shiro提供一種Realm實(shí)現(xiàn)腐芍。用戶、角色试躏、權(quán)限等信息集中在一個.ini文件那里猪勇。 users開始的標(biāo)簽說明...
Shiro是一個用于驗(yàn)證和授權(quán)的框架。下面將以一個測試開始對Shiro的認(rèn)識: testAuthentication方法是我們的真正要測...
在處理請求的過程中可能產(chǎn)生異常颠蕴,如果這個異常表明這次請求不會得到正常的處理泣刹,那么應(yīng)當(dāng)向用戶告知。Spring已經(jīng)內(nèi)置了一些規(guī)則犀被,當(dāng)在處理請求的過...